ELECTION - Delhi HC Dismisses Plea Against Tamil Nadu CM E Palaniswami and Deputy CM O Paneerselvam - (30 Mar 2019)

ELECTION

Delhi High Court has dismissed petition filed by former MP KC Palanisamy seeking directions to restrain AIADMK coordinator O Panneerselvam and joint coordinator Edappadi K Palaniswami from signing Forms A and B to be filed along with nomination papers of candidates for Lok Sabha elections.
